Accounting Officer

Abuja Full-time Undisclosed
Job Description
Job Summary


The Accounting Officer is responsible for maintaining accurate financial records, processing financial transactions, supporting budgeting and financial reporting, managing receivables and payables, and ensuring compliance with financial policies and statutory regulations. The successful candidate will contribute to the efficient financial operations of the school while maintaining the highest standards of accuracy, integrity, and confidentiality.


Key Responsibilities


Financial Transactions



• Record daily financial transactions accurately in the school's accounting system.

• Prepare and process payment vouchers, receipts, invoices, and journal entries.

• Ensure all financial transactions are properly authorized and supported by relevant documentation.

• Maintain accurate records of all income and expenditure.



Accounts Receivable



• Monitor and manage student tuition and other fee collections.

• Prepare and issue invoices, receipts, and account statements.

• Follow up on outstanding school fees and other receivables professionally and promptly.

• Reconcile student accounts and investigate discrepancies.



Accounts Payable



• Process supplier invoices and staff reimbursement claims.

• Prepare payment schedules and ensure timely settlement of approved obligations.

• Reconcile supplier statements and resolve outstanding issues.

• Maintain accurate records of creditors and payment histories.



Bank & Cash Management



• Perform daily, weekly, and monthly bank reconciliations.

• Monitor cash flow and maintain petty cash records.

• Prepare cash summaries and reconcile cash balances.

• Ensure secure handling of cash and banking transactions.



Payroll Support



• Assist in preparing payroll information and verifying payroll data.

• Maintain records relating to salaries, allowances, deductions, and statutory remittances.

• Ensure payroll documentation is complete and accurate.



Budgeting & Financial Reporting



• Assist in preparing annual budgets and periodic financial forecasts.

• Pr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ports.

• Analyze financial data and provide management with relevant insights.

• Monitor departmental expenditure against approved budgets.



Financial Compliance



• Ensure compliance with accounting standards, internal financial policies, and applicable Nigerian tax regulations.

• Assist in preparing statutory returns and regulatory reports.

• Support internal and external audit exercises.

• Maintain accurate documentation for audit purposes.



Asset & Inventory Management



• Maintain the school's fixed asset register.

• Record acquisitions, disposals, and depreciation of assets.

• Participate in periodic inventory verification and asset audits.



Financial Records Management



• Maintain accurate electronic and physical accounting records.

• Ensure proper filing and archiving of financial documents.

• Safeguard confidential financial information.



Administrative Support



• Assist with procurement documentation and financial approvals where required.

• Support the Finance Manager in implementing financial policies and internal controls.

• Perform other accounting and finance duties assigned by management.
